有服务器如何上传源码
-
服务器上上传源码的步骤如下:
- 登录服务器:使用SSH工具(如PuTTY)通过输入服务器IP地址和登录凭证登录服务器。
- 创建文件夹:可以选择在服务器上创建一个新的文件夹来存放源码,使用命令“mkdir 文件夹名称”创建文件夹。
- 进入文件夹:使用命令“cd 文件夹名称”进入刚刚创建的文件夹。
- 上传源码:使用SCP或SFTP工具(如WinSCP、FileZilla等)连接服务器,然后将源码文件从本地计算机拖放到服务器上的文件夹中。或者使用命令“scp 源码文件路径 目标服务器用户名@目标服务器IP:目标路径”上传源码。
- 检查上传:使用命令“ls”查看文件夹中的文件列表,确保源码已经成功上传到服务器上。
以上就是上传源码到服务器的基本步骤。请注意,服务器上的文件路径和访问权限可能会有所不同,具体步骤可能因服务器操作系统的不同而有所差异。在操作之前,建议您先仔细阅读服务器操作系统的相关文档或向服务器管理员咨询。
1年前 -
上传源码到服务器可以通过以下步骤完成:
-
获取服务器登录凭证:获取服务器的IP地址、用户名和密码或者私钥文件。这些凭证将用于建立与服务器的连接。
-
连接到服务器:使用SSH工具(例如OpenSSH或PuTTY)连接到服务器。使用提供的凭证,通过SSH协议建立与服务器的安全连接。
-
创建目录:在服务器上创建一个用于存放源码的目录。可以使用命令
mkdir创建目录。例如,mkdir /home/user/source_code将在服务器的主目录下创建一个名为source_code的目录。 -
上传源码:将本地的源码文件上传到服务器上的目录。可以使用
scp命令(Secure Copy)进行文件传输。例如,scp /path/to/source_code.zip user@server_ip:/home/user/source_code将本地的source_code.zip文件上传到服务器上的source_code目录。 -
解压源码:如果源码是一个压缩文件(如ZIP或TAR),则需要在服务器上解压缩它。可以使用命令
unzip或tar来解压缩文件。例如,unzip /home/user/source_code/source_code.zip -d /home/user/source_code将解压缩source_code.zip到source_code目录。 -
检查上传结果:验证源码是否成功上传到服务器上的目录。可以使用
ls命令来列出目录中的文件。例如,ls /home/user/source_code将显示源码文件列表。
除了以上步骤,还可以考虑以下几点来优化源码上传的过程:
-
使用版本控制系统:使用Git等版本控制系统来管理源码,并通过远程仓库实现源码上传到服务器。这样可以方便地进行版本控制和代码管理。
-
自动部署工具:考虑使用自动化部署工具(例如Jenkins)来实现源码的自动上传和部署。这样可以减少手动操作的复杂性和出错的可能性。
-
保护源码安全:在上传源码之前,确保源码的安全性。可以使用加密算法对源码进行加密,以保护源码的机密性。
-
备份源码:上传源码之后,最好定期进行源码的备份,以防止意外丢失或损坏。可以定期将源码文件复制到其他存储设备或云存储中。
-
设置访问权限:根据需要,设置源码目录的访问权限,以确保只有合适的用户或团队可以访问和修改源码文件。可以使用
chmod命令设置文件权限。
通过以上步骤和注意事项,您可以成功地将源码上传到服务器,并确保源码的安全和完整性。
1年前 -
-
上传源码到服务器可以通过以下步骤进行操作:
步骤一:准备工作
确保您已经获得要上传的源码,并将其保存在本地计算机上。
步骤二:选择上传方式
服务器上传源码的方式有多种选择,常见的方式有 FTP、SSH 和控制面板。
-
FTP:使用 FTP 客户端软件,通过 FTP 协议将源码上传到服务器。如果您使用 Windows 操作系统,可以使用 FileZilla 这样的软件。如果您使用 macOS 或 Linux 操作系统,可以使用命令行中的 ftp 命令。
-
SSH:通过 SSH 协议使用命令行工具(如 PuTTY)连接到服务器,然后使用 scp 命令将源码传输到服务器。这种方式需要您具备一定的命令行操作能力。
-
控制面板:如果您的服务器提供了 Web 控制面板(如 cPanel、Plesk 或者自定义控制面板),您可以直接通过控制面板的文件管理功能上传源码。通常,控制面板提供一个简单的文件上传界面,您只需选择源码文件并上传即可。
在选择上传方式时,您需要考虑自己的技术水平和服务器环境,选择最适合您的方式。
步骤三:连接服务器
根据您选择的上传方式,按照对应的方法连接到服务器。如果使用 FTP 客户端软件,需要提供服务器的主机名(或 IP 地址)、用户名和密码。如果使用 SSH,需要提供服务器的 IP 地址、用户名和密码(或者私钥)。如果使用控制面板,需要提供控制面板的登录地址、用户名和密码。
步骤四:上传源码
在成功连接到服务器后,您将看到服务器上的文件目录结构。您可以浏览到您想要上传源码的目录。
根据您选择的上传方式,进行相应的操作:
-
FTP:在 FTP 客户端软件中,找到本地的源码文件目录和服务器的目标目录。然后将本地文件拖放到服务器目录中,或者在 FTP 客户端软件中使用上传功能上传源码文件。
-
SSH:在命令行中,使用 scp 命令进行文件传输。例如,使用以下命令将本地源码文件上传到服务器的目标目录中:
scp /path/to/local/source/file username@server-ip:/path/to/target/directory其中,
/path/to/local/source/file是本地源码文件的路径,username是服务器的用户名,server-ip是服务器的 IP 地址,/path/to/target/directory是服务器的目标目录。 -
控制面板:打开控制面板的文件管理功能,找到您要上传源码的目标目录。然后使用控制面板提供的上传功能,选择源码文件并上传。
步骤五:验证上传
上传源码后,您可以在服务器上进行一些验证工作,以确保源码已成功上传。例如,查看服务器上的源码文件,或者在服务器上编译和运行源码。
总结:
上传源码到服务器需要选择上传方式,常用的方式有 FTP、SSH 和控制面板。连接到服务器后,在选择的方式上进行相应操作,将源码文件上传到服务器的目标目录中。最后,进行验证以确保源码已成功上传。
1年前 -